Establishment and operation of makeup shops
Duty to complete hygiene education
Completion of hygiene education
- A makeup shop operator (including a transferee and successor; the same shall apply hereinafter) shall receive 3 hours of hygiene education from the Korea Make-up Central Association every year [Article 17 (1) of the Public Health Control Act, Article 23 (1) of the Enforcement Regulations of the Public Health Control Act, and Subparagraph 2 of the Designation of Organization to Carry Out Hygiene Education for Public Hygiene Business Operators, etc. (Ministry of Health and Welfare Public Notice No. 2016-139, issued and implemented on August 1, 2016)].
ㆍ However, those who operate or wish to operate makeup shops on islands or remote areas publicly notified by the Minister of Health and Welfare may substitute the hygiene education with learning and utilizing of teaching materials published by the Korea Make-up Central Association (Article 23 (3) and (8) of the Enforcement Regulations of the Public Health Control Act).
※ Island and remote areas publicly notified by the Minister of Health and Welfare may be ascertained on Public Hygiene Education Materials Distribution and Substitution - Island and Remote Areas (Ministry of Health and Welfare Public Notice).
- The hygiene education shall provide teaching related to the Public Health Control Act and related regulations, courtesy training (including matters related to hospitality and cleanliness), technical training, and other details necessary to ensure the maintenance of public hygiene (Article 23 (2) of the Enforcement Regulations of the Public Health Control Act).
Designation of a person in charge of public hygiene
- Of the makeup shop operators, those who are not directly engaged in the business or those who conduct business at least in two places, shall designate a person in charge of the affairs regarding public hygiene for each business establishment from among their employees and have such person receive the hygiene education (Article 17 (3) of the Public Health Control Act).
Receipt of certificate for completion of hygiene education
- The president of the Korea Make-up Central Association shall issue a certificate of completion of hygiene education to a person who completes the hygiene education (Former part of Article 23 (9) of the Enforcement Regulations of the Public Health Control Act).
Sanctions in case of violation
- A person who has failed to receive hygiene education in breach of the above shall be subject to an administrative fine not exceeding KRW 2 million (Subparagraph 6 of Article 22 (2) of the Public Health Control Act).
